Safe, structured housing environments that provide stability for individuals transitioning from crisis, recovery, or reentry, with built-in support to promote independence and long-term success.
Short-term care services that offer temporary relief for caregivers while ensuring individuals continue to receive safe, supportive, and attentive care.
Recovery-focused support provided by individuals with lived experience, helping clients navigate challenges, set goals, and build confidence through guidance, mentorship, and encouragement.
Practical training designed to strengthen daily living abilities, including budgeting, communication, time management, and decision-making to support independent living.
Programs that prepare individuals for employment through job readiness training, resume building, interview skills, and connection to career opportunities.
Collaborative support that connects individuals to essential services, ensuring their physical, mental, and social needs are addressed through a coordinated care approach.
Linkage to trusted local resources and partner organizations to help individuals access housing, healthcare, employment, and other critical support services.
